How To Find The Thieves Guild

Finding the Thieves Guildin Cyrodiil can be difficult. You’ll seeposters around the Imperial Citydepicting the Gray Fox, and guards will warn you about the mysterious group. Some citizens will even question the existence of the Thieves Guild, butonly the beggars knowthe truth.

To join the Thieves Guild, you’ll need tobefriend aBeggarin the Imperial City. Use the persuasion minigame toraise their dispositionabove 70 before asking about the Gray Fox.

You may need to bribe the beggars with some coin as well, if all else fails.

Once you befriend abeggar, they’ll ask why you’relooking for the Gray Fox. Tell them that you’re hoping to join the guild andwork for the Gray Foxto learn that there’s ameeting in the Garden of Dareloth at midnight.

How To Start The May The BestThiefWin Quest

Head to the Waterfront District, thenmake your way to the outskirtswhere the shacks are. Here is where you’ll find a garden, along withseveral thieves at midnight.

Speak with Armand Christopheto learn that the two others gathered in the garden with you are your competitors. The challenge is tosteal the diary of Amantius Allectus. Whoever gets the diary and returns it to Armand the next night will earn a spot in the guild.

Do not kill Amantius Allectus! You’re athief, not a murderer.

The May The BestThiefWin quest is timed, and your competitor Methredhel will take off running. She knows exactly where to go, so you caneither follow her or ask the beggarsaround for more information.

It’sbest to follow Methredhel, as she will likely get to the diary before you. However, you can stillsnatch it before herif you act fast. Make sure you haveplenty of lockpicksbefore heading out.

You can buy more from Armand for five gold each.

Where To Find Amantius Allectus' Diary

Amantius Allectus' diary is in his home,in the Temple District. Once there, make a right and follow the path along the wall to reach his house beside the next gate. Pick the lock on the door and break into his home.

The lock only has two tumblersto pick, so it shouldn’t be too hard. Once inside,creep over to the deskon the first floor andgrab the diary, then flee the home andreturn to Armand.

If you’re fast enough, you can complete the quest the very same night you start it.

However, if youfail to get the diary, your journal will update you thatMethredhel has it. You’ll need to steal it back from her, as she’shidden it within her home.

Find her house in the Waterfront District, near the garden where you meet Armand.Pick the lockon her door and the lock on the chest next to it. Be quick,grab the diary, and return to Armand with it at midnight in the garden toearn your spotin the Thieves Guild.

Where To FindRohssan’s Antique Cutlass

If Methredhel gets the diary and returns it to Armand, you’re able to still join the Thieves Guild. Armand will give youa second chance, this time sending you tostealRohssan’s Antique Cutlassfrom the owner ofA Fighting Chance in the Market District.

This is your last chance! If youfail to retrieve the cutlassbefore the deadline,May The BestThiefWin will fail, and you’ll bebarred from joiningthe guild.

Pick the average level lockon the door at night, thenhead up the stairsand pick the easy lock. There’saguarddog on the other sideof the door, and he’ll attack on sight. If you move quickly, you’re able to avoid killing the dog.

Theguarddog will wake the owners if you linger too long, so get moving!

Head to the right andpick the lock on a very easy chest,then snatchRohssan’s Antique Cutlassand make your way back to Armand in the garden. You’llofficially join the Thieves Guildand unlock your first fence. From here, you’re on your own.

Start breaking into comely homes andfencing the valuables to increase your rankwithin the guild and unlock more quests.
